Care & Maintenance of microscope parts

Care & Maintenance of microscope parts

A well-maintained microscope parts gives reliable performance and long operating life. Check optical elements regularly for dust, fingerprint, or oil residue. Use only authorized manufacturer cleaning materials to prevent lens coating damage. Store the microscope parts upright, supported, and covered when not in use. Check focusing mechanisms for smooth operation and illumination system for uniform brightness. Standard maintenance procedures minimize downtime and preserve imaging quality for education and research.

FAQ

  • Q: What is the lifespan of a microscope? A: With proper care and maintenance, a microscope can last for many years, providing consistent optical performance and stability.

    Q: How does the objective lens affect image quality in a microscope? A: The objective lens determines magnification and resolution; high-quality lenses produce sharper, more accurate images of specimens.

    Q: Can a microscope be used to view live specimens? A: Yes, many microscope models support live-cell observation, allowing users to study biological processes in real time under controlled conditions.

    Q: What is the function of the condenser in a microscope? A: The condenser focuses light onto the specimen, enhancing illumination and improving contrast for clear image viewing.

    Q: How should a microscope be transported safely? A: Carry the microscope with both hands—one under the base and one on the arm—to prevent damage or misalignment of delicate parts.
